The Capella’s hybrid engine cuts carbon emissions by 25 per cent and nitrogen oxides by 90 per cent - adequate eco-cred to stay the course. Norway plans to enact the world’s first zero-emissions control area at sea along its ragged coastline by 2026, meaning that most cruise ships will no longer be welcome in the fjords. The late-night crawl through Tengelfjord, hemmed in by snowy cliffs on either side, is eerily cinematic. Close your eyes when the captain kills the engine and it’s easy to imagine that you’re drifting through the icy blue in a kayak. The 78-tonne battery pack, running the length of the engine room like bookshelves at a library, generates power equal to about 600 Teslas, and can be topped up at the quay. The world’s largest battery-capacity vessel, it can waft through Norway’s Unesco world heritage-listed fjords emissions free, with nary a roar for four hours on the trot. ![]() The layered interiors of the Capella heighten the sense of tranquillity, stashing its 640 passengers into intimate conversation pits and fireside clusters, or deep armchairs by the full-height windows.Īlso, the Capella is the Toyota Prius of cruise ships. Northwestern Italy has been hit by record rainfall from a complex of thunderstorms, triggering flooding and mudslides, per AP. In just 12 hours, 29.2 inches of rain fell in Rossiglione in Italy’s Genoa province, roughly 65 miles south-southwest of Milan and 10 miles north of the Mediterranean coastline. Terrestrial frogs which include the spring peeper, generally take cover on land. At this time, the frogs either bury themselves partially in the mud or stay in the mud at the bottom of the lake or perhaps just swim around. Frogs of the aquatic type hibernate below water and inhale the oxygen in the water through their skin. Their breathing process and heart beat become slow, the temperature of their body falls to equalize with the outside temperature, where they while away their time in a dormant state or in inactivity. ![]() Hibernation is a process used by frogs to flee from the freezing temperature during winter. New York was no-hit for just the eighth time ever and just the sixth time at home. Three have been combined efforts, also a record. The Astros now have 14 no-hitters in their history, the most in the majors since Houston began play in 1962. In that game, across the street at the old Yankee Stadium, Roy Oswalt strained his right groin after his second pitch of the second inning, and Pete Munro (2⅔ innings), Kirk Saarloos (1⅓), Brad Lidge (2), Octavio Dotel (1) and Billy Wagner (1) followed in an 8-0 win. Both have come at the hands of the Astros, who had six pitchers combine for a no-hitter at Yankee Stadium on June 11, 2003. Only two no-hitters have been thrown against the Yankees since Baltimore's Hoyt Wilhelm did it in 1958. The Queen was required to give consent to the marriage, but Parliament, the Cabinet, and the Church of England were firmly against the marriage, stating they would not approve. Princess Margaret was infatuated and informed The Queen that she wished to marry him. Group Captain Townsend was divorced from his wife in 1953, with whom he had two children. ![]() Princess Margaret and The Queen Mother moved out of Buckingham Palace and into Clarence House upon Elizabeth’s accession to the throne. Group Captain Townsend had been one of her father’s equerries and became The Queen Mother’s comptroller. Princess Margaret, in her grief, turned to Group Captain Peter Townsend for comfort. King George VI died on 6 February 1952 after a battle with lung cancer, and Princess Elizabeth became Queen Elizabeth II.
